Fall/Winter 2006-07

Nathaniel Goldberg’s second campaign for Piazza Sempione, titled “A City, A Woman,” is composed of a series of snapshots tracing a woman during her busy day. Goldberg employed a special crane to hoist himself 60 feet above the New York city pavement in order to capture a special angle on model Morgane Dubled. The unique vantage point serves to highlight the natural environment and allows the graphic quality of the photos to clearly emerge. Goldberg was inspired by the film “Lost in Translation” for the urban mood and though the shoot took place in New York City, the resulting effect relates to any cement-lined modern metropolis that moves at a speedy pace. This woman’s allure, simplicity and elegance offer a thoughtful counter point to the fast city in which she lives.
